What Is an Oscillating Spindle and Belt Sander and How Does It Work?

An oscillating spindle and belt sander is a versatile power tool designed for sanding and shaping wood and other materials. It combines two sanding mechanisms: a rotating belt and an oscillating spindle, which work together to create a smooth finish on various surfaces. The belt sander uses a continuous loop of sandpaper that moves over a flat surface, while the oscillating spindle sander features a cylindrical spindle that moves up and down in an oscillating motion, allowing for detailed work on edges and contours.

According to the American Woodworking Association, oscillating spindle sanders are particularly favored for their ability to provide a uniform finish and are ideal for sanding curves and intricate shapes due to their spindle’s movement. This dual-functioning tool is essential for both professional woodworkers and DIY enthusiasts who seek efficiency and precision in their projects.

Key aspects of an oscillating spindle and belt sander include its ability to handle a range of sanding tasks, from rough shaping to fine finishing. The belt sander is excellent for removing material quickly and is suitable for flat surfaces, while the oscillating spindle sander allows for more delicate work, such as smoothing edges and contours. The oscillation helps to prevent the sandpaper from clogging, thus prolonging its lifespan and maintaining effectiveness during operation. The combination of these two sanding methods in one machine saves time and workspace, making it a popular choice in workshops.

This tool significantly impacts woodworking by improving the quality of finishes and reducing the labor required for manual sanding. For instance, the oscillating spindle’s ability to reach tight corners and curves means that woodworkers can achieve a higher level of craftsmanship without the tedious effort of hand sanding. In terms of applications, it is widely used in furniture making, cabinetry, and craft projects where precision is paramount.

Statistics indicate that using power sanders can reduce sanding time by up to 70% compared to traditional hand sanding methods, which enhances productivity and allows artisans to focus on other aspects of their work. Additionally, the efficiency of these sanders can lead to increased profitability for small woodworking businesses, as they can handle more projects in less time.

Best practices for using an oscillating spindle and belt sander include regularly checking and replacing sandpaper to ensure optimal performance, maintaining proper dust collection systems to keep the workspace clean, and utilizing the right speed settings for different materials to prevent damage. Furthermore, safety measures such as wearing protective eyewear and ensuring that the workpiece is securely clamped can lead to safer and more effective sanding operations.

What Features Enhance Performance in an Oscillating Spindle and Belt Sander?

When selecting an oscillating spindle and belt sander, several features contribute to enhanced performance:

  • Variable Speed Control: This feature allows users to adjust the sanding speed according to the material being worked on, providing greater flexibility and preventing damage to delicate surfaces.

  • Dust Collection System: An efficient dust collection system helps maintain a clean workspace and improves visibility. A better dust collection mechanism minimizes the time spent on cleanup and enhances the user’s ability to see the project clearly.

  • Sanding Arm Adjustment: A versatile sanding arm that can be easily adjusted or removed increases adaptability for various sanding projects, allowing smooth transitions between spindle and belt sanding tasks.

  • Power and Motor Strength: A more powerful motor can handle tough materials and prolonged use without overheating. Typically, a motor with at least 1.5 horsepower is suitable for most applications.

  • Ergonomic Design: Comfortable grips and well-placed controls reduce fatigue during prolonged use, fostering better handling and precision.

  • Sturdy Build Quality: A solid construction with quality materials increases durability and stability, which is essential for consistent sanding performance.

These features collectively enhance efficiency and precision, making the sander a valuable tool for any workshop.

How Can You Ensure Safety When Using an Oscillating Spindle and Belt Sander?

Ensuring safety when using an oscillating spindle and belt sander involves several key practices:

  • Personal Protective Equipment (PPE): Always wear appropriate PPE such as safety goggles, dust masks, and hearing protection to shield yourself from dust, debris, and noise.
  • Proper Setup and Maintenance: Ensure your sander is set up on a stable, level surface, and perform regular maintenance checks to keep it in good working order.
  • Understanding the Tool: Familiarize yourself with the sander’s features, controls, and limitations to operate it safely and effectively.
  • Workpiece Security: Secure your workpiece firmly to prevent movement during sanding, as this can lead to accidents or injuries.
  • Safe Operation Techniques: Use both hands to control the sander, maintain a firm grip, and avoid wearing loose clothing or jewelry that could get caught in the machinery.

What Maintenance Tips Extend the Life of Your Oscillating Spindle and Belt Sander?

To extend the life of your oscillating spindle and belt sander, consider the following maintenance tips:

  • Regular Cleaning: Keeping your sander clean is crucial for its longevity. Dust and debris can accumulate in the motor and other components, leading to overheating and reduced performance. Use a soft brush or compressed air to remove dust from the sander after each use.
  • Inspect and Replace Sanding Belts: Worn or damaged sanding belts can lead to poor performance and increased strain on the sander. Regularly check the belts for signs of wear, such as fraying or tearing, and replace them as necessary to maintain optimal sanding efficiency.
  • Lubricate Moving Parts: Lubrication is essential to ensure smooth operation of moving parts, which can reduce wear and tear. Use a suitable lubricant on bearings and pivot points as recommended by the manufacturer to minimize friction.
  • Check Electrical Components: Periodically inspect the electrical components, including cords and switches, for any signs of damage or wear. Faulty wiring can not only impair performance but also pose safety risks, so replace any damaged parts immediately.
  • Keep the Work Area Clean: A clean workspace helps prevent dust and debris from entering the sander, which can affect its operation. Regularly clean the area around your sander and ensure proper dust collection systems are in place to maintain a tidy environment.
